Created almost a year ago, the special commission of the Chamber of Deputies to analyze a project that amends the General Data Protection Law (LGPD) is still not working in practice.

The project, by former deputy Coronel Armando (PL-SC), provides rules for the protection of personal data for purposes of state security, national defense, public safety and investigation and repression of criminal offenses. The themes were set aside in the LGPD, created in 2018.

The proposal is being processed conclusively, in a commission created on June 20 last year by the Board of Directors of the Chamber.

The text allows the sharing of personal data controlled by public security agencies in exceptional cases, when there is a public interest and provided that the protection standards provided for in the project are observed.

The project also allows the transfer of personal data to international organizations that work in the area of ​​public security.

In the justification for the project, the author stated that the objective was “to harmonize the duties of the State in the exercise of security activities and the observance of the procedural guarantees of Brazilian citizens with regard to the processing of personal data”.

The way the project was conceived has raised concerns among some specialists.

For criminalist Carolina Carvalho de Oliveira, partner at Campos & Antonioli Advogados Associados, the project will revolutionize the criminal procedural system, as the illegal transmission of data will be considered a crime.

“But we cannot forget that, since 2022, data protection has become a fundamental right and, therefore, must already be respected, under penalty of abuse of authority, regardless of regulation by specific law”, he says”.

Other points questioned are the fact that inspection will be the responsibility of the National Data Protection Authority (ANPD), which still has a modest structure, permission for the circulation of data without a judicial request and mild penalties for violating the law, as a warning and administrative accountability of public servants.
